Show " OBITUARY. ! i Slattery. Father M. Slattery. who was a native of Tallow county, Watcrford. Ireland, and vicar general of the diocese of Gouldbourn, died recently. He was pastor of Wagga Wagga, Australia, for many years. In 1S83 Father Slattery, accompanied by the present bishop of Gouldbourn, Rt. Rev. John Gallagher, visited Salt Lake and was the guest of Bishop Scanlan, who then resided in the rear of St. Mary's church. Though innured to hardship in the Australian bush, nowhere did the visitors see primitive apostolic missionary life so faithfully carried out as in Salt Lake. Between our bishop and the two Australian Aus-tralian missionaries a warm friendship has existed since their visit to this city. R. I. I. , Frey. Lottie B. Frey, of Genoa.
